The church of Santi Luca e Martina Via della Curia at the edge of the roman forum Rome Italy roma lazio italy EU Europe
Size: 3725px × 5588px
Location: ROME ITALY
Photo credit: © eye35 /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: blue, catholic, church, italian, italy, luca, luke, martina, religious, rome, santa, santi, sky